How do I install and maintain an hp imaging drum to ensure compatibility and longevity?
To install an hp imaging drum, power off the printer, open the access panel, remove the old unit, and insert a new HP Genuine imaging drum designed for your printer family. Run a calibration or alignment page to ensure proper imaging alignment, then store and handle the drum by its edges, avoiding contact with the coating. Keep the drum out of direct sunlight and follow packaging guidance to prevent damage before use. Regularly check for firmware or driver updates that can affect compatibility with imaging drums.
What common mistakes should I avoid when buying or replacing an hp imaging drum?
Avoid mixing drums with incompatible models or using non-HP imaging drums that claim compatibility, as this can lead to poor image quality or printer errors. Don’t install a damaged or used drum, and don’t force-fit a drum rated for another printer family into your unit. Refrain from skipping the calibration step after replacement, and never touch the drum surface with bare fingers.
